ROCKIN' us into the midnight hour is our brotha JAYVI VELASCO, "the DJ's DJ" - 

Jayvi Velasco began mixing records in the early 1990s with 2 turntables, a mixer & 2 crates of mostly house records. Since then he has played at literally hundreds of events from California to Manila ranging from clubs, undergrounds, massive raves, boat parties, house parties, loft parties, and renegade beach parties. His smooth and seamless style of deep, sexy, jazzy, soulful, funky, Afro-Latin-tinged vocal House music has lead him to share billing with some of the global house heavyweights including: Timmy Regisford, Vikter Duplaix, Osunlade, Simbad, Ron Carroll, Mark Farina, Gene Farris, Master Kev, Mr.V, Alix Alvarez, Carlos Mena, David Harness, Halo, Patrick Wilson, Miguel Migs, Jay-J, Julius Papp, Ruben Mancias, Simon, Jeno, Garth, Tony, DJ Dan, and Soulstice. Underground househeads are craving the resurgence of the recently quieted but still reverberating "AfterAfterHours", the longest running soulful House afterhours party in San Francisco that Jayvi founded as both co-host and resident dj.

ROCKIN' us into the early mornin' is NESTO FUENTEZ -

Reared among the sounds of classic funk, soul, and latin jazz, Nesto was also heavily influenced and deeply inspired by the thriving San Francisco underground of the late 90’s. Nesto has since sculpted a sound that’s both unique and versatile, a sound that’s been rockin the dance floors since 2002. He’s been blessed with opportunities to collaborate with key players in both the clubs and the underground scene with local heroes like Rick Preston, M3, and Leonard AND with living legends like Doc Martin, Evil Eddie Richards, Terry Francis, Pete Moss, Nathan Coles, Mark Bell, Halo, Tony Rodriquez aka BROTERS VIBE, Tony Hewitt, and Steve Loria, and important, creative promoters like Sunday Mass, m.deep music, CJ Larsen, and TropicalSF. Nesto has helped piece together some of the most epic parties with Tribal Souls, Tocadisco, Monday Night Grooves and Sulco. His ECLECTIC sound is warm, dirty, tech, yet never betrays it’s underlying Afro-Latin Soul.
